  4. Beyond JavaScript: The Real Benefit of React Native

Wojciech Ogrodowczyk at React Alicante 2017

React Native, although still a really small part of the mobile development ecosystem, is growing really fast. A lot of "real native" developers dismiss it, because of their previous experiences with JavaScript - a language not easy to love. However, they're missing an important point - it's so much more than JS. In this talk I will show how we can create React Native applications with various alternative languages. Starting with a typed version of JS: TypeScript, going through a dynamic functional language Clojure, up till statically typed options with 20-year old OCaml and 5-year old Elm. Expect fast pace, code, and weird syntax. But, most importantly, we'll talk about why this freedom is so important and why this can make your applications better.